Andersson's arctic moss vs serrated earth moss
Arctoa anderssonii compared with Ephemerum serratum
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Andersson's arctic moss | serrated earth moss |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Plantae (Plants) | Plantae (Plants) |
| Phylum same | Bryophyta | Bryophyta |
| Class same | Bryopsida (Bryopsida) | Bryopsida (Bryopsida) |
| Order | Dicranales (Dicranales) | Pottiales (Pottiales) |
| Family | Rhabdoweisiaceae | Ephemeraceae |
| Genus | Arctoa | Ephemerum |
| Species | Arctoa anderssonii | Ephemerum serratum |
Evolutionary Relationship
Andersson's arctic moss and serrated earth moss share a common ancestor at the Class level: Bryopsida. (Bryopsida)
